The Vita is excellent. It's a shame that they are poorly marketed and most people don't care about them because it's probably one of the best handhelds ever made.

It's powerful, the interface is clean, it controls well, the remote play feature is great with the PS4 and if you like PS1 games, nearly all of them are available.

I wouldn't recommend one to everyone but if you have some free time at work, travel a lot of commute on a bus/subway, it's awesome. I always have mine with me at work and games like Hotline Miami pass the time quickly.
